Police Arrest Cousin In Connection With Death Of ‘Baby Hope’


Police announced Saturday the arrest of a man in connection with the death of a young girl who became known as “Baby Hope.”


According to Police Commissioner Ray Kelly, Conrado Juarez, 52, of the Bronx was apprehended Friday afternoon by the Bronx Violent Felony Squad.


According to investigators, Juarez admitted to sexually assaulting and smothering 4-year-old Angelica Castillo in Queens before disposing of her body in a cooler.


The young girl’s body was found near the Henry Hudson Parkway in July 1991.


The girl weighed just 25 pounds when she was found.


Police say Juarez, who is a cousin of Castillo, was aided in disposing of the body by his sister, who is now deceased.


Earlier this month, police announced that they identified Castillo’s mother through DNA testing.


Her arms were tied, and she appeared to have been starved, beaten and abused.


This summer, police recently renewed their push to solve this case, releasing photos to the media.


Police say an anonymous tip led them to the mother.
